A PROPOSAL TO ATTAIN THE D-D IGNITION

Abstract
We propose the possibility to ignite the D-D reactor from the D-T reactor by increasing the deuterium density and reducing the tritium density. Supposing that the D-T reactor has been already realized and the plasma parameters are in the Trapped Ion Regime, the D-D reactor is possibly ignited by continuously developing the plasma parameters from the D-T reactor. The dynamics of the transition is calculated, and it becomes clear that the additional heating in the initial state is very effective. The characteristics of the D-D reactor are also shown. The loss rate of tritium from the core plasma is one order less than that of the conventional D-T reactor. At last the modified D-T reactor which is aimed to improve the tritium breeding ratio in the Li blanket is introduced.
